Downey City Library Youth Programs offers activities such as Sign, Say & Play, where children and caregivers learn signs and songs through activities and play, and Rimas y Ritmos, a hands-on music and movement experience in Spanish for little ones and caregivers. The program also includes LEGO Builders Club with hands-on LEGO play and creative building challenges, Storytime for Library Littles (Preschool-English) with read-alouds plus themes that may include activities, playtime, or crafts, and Family Rhythms, where families clap, sing, and dance together while exploring rhythms, instruments, and songs. Additional options include the Columbia Memorial Space Center: STEM Workshop to build STEM projects, the STEM Mobile Makers-Summer Session for grades 3–5 with hands-on science and engineering activities and design-based challenges, a TTRPG Club focused on tabletop role-playing games, and a live musical Special Performance: Twinkle Time, described as a one-of-a-kind musical experience blending pop, Broadway, hip hop, and EDM glam and described as “like Lady Gaga for kids.”
• Ages: 0–18 years old
• Schedule: Sessions range from 30 minutes to 2 hours 30 minutes, with some programs meeting weekly, monthly, every other Wednesday, or as a 12-week series.
• Price: Sign, Say & Play requires registration; Rimas y Ritmos is free with in-person registration; LEGO Builders Club, Storytime for Library Littles (Preschool-English), Columbia Memorial Space Center: STEM Workshop, and Special Performance: Twinkle Time do not require registration; Family Rhythms is free with no registration required; TTRPG Club and STEM Mobile Makers-Summer Session (3rd–5th Grade) require registration.
The mission of Downey City Library Youth Programs is “Igniting a community of creative and critical thinkers.” The TTRPG Club is led by veteran Game Master Mark Shocklee. The STEM Mobile Makers program is led by California State University, Long Beach (CSULB) students who help develop, organize, and implement the program at libraries throughout the greater area, and the summer session is hosted by educators from California State University, Long Beach. The Columbia Memorial Space Center: STEM Workshop is hosted by the Columbia Memorial Space Center. Downey City Library is a selective government depository for both the U.S. Government Publishing Office and State of California materials and offers free public access to information produced by Federal agencies as part of the Federal Depository Library Program, as well as free WiFi at four Virtual Library sites throughout the City of Downey. Caregiver supervision is required for Sign, Say & Play, Rimas y Ritmos, LEGO Builders Club, Storytime for Library Littles (Preschool-English), Family Rhythms, and the Columbia Memorial Space Center: STEM Workshop, and a parent or guardian must sign in students for the STEM Mobile Makers-Summer Session (3rd–5th Grade). Registration for Rimas y Ritmos is completed in person at the Info Desk, and families can sign up for the waitlist for Sign, Say & Play, with invitations sent out as spots open.
